RANGANATH MISRA, J. :- All these appeals are by special leave and are directed against judgments rendered by the Kerala High Court in Writ Petitions filed before it. The High Court in each case refused to grant relief.
2. Two Notifications/Orders issued by the State Government are relevant. The first one is dated 11-4-1979 and the second is dated 29-9-1980 which was published in the State Gazette on 21-10-1980. For convenience, the texts of the two Notifications/Orders are extracted below :
"Order dated 11-4-1979 :
The incentives now given to the industries in the State are too meagre and inadequate to attract industries to this State when compared to the incentives available for the industries in many other States. Further there are certain inherent disincentives also peculiar to this State such as high wage rates, minimum wages for certain sections, lack of availability of raw materials, etc. The question of offering some incentives by the State to attract new industries has been under consideration of the Government.
